OSDN Git Service

libhardware: report stride on dequeue_buffer
[android-x86/hardware-libhardware.git] / include / hardware / camera.h
index 20d58d4..4db6ad7 100644 (file)
@@ -93,7 +93,7 @@ typedef void (*camera_data_timestamp_callback)(int64_t timestamp,
 
 typedef struct preview_stream_ops {
     int (*dequeue_buffer)(struct preview_stream_ops* w,
-                buffer_handle_t** buffer);
+                          buffer_handle_t** buffer, int *stride);
     int (*enqueue_buffer)(struct preview_stream_ops* w,
                 buffer_handle_t* buffer);
     int (*cancel_buffer)(struct preview_stream_ops* w,